Output 2ca70b590b2336db3c0b130597af4ae3326d9ec3314660d1f3b488650e27c60c:12

value
341248892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ea9196c03b690c7366c681d144808f2e342e1e0b OP_EQUAL
address
3P5JT89trcMWULKU7QrdT19LJvCizsWWWQ
transaction
2ca70b590b2336db3c0b130597af4ae3326d9ec3314660d1f3b488650e27c60c
spent
true